Overview

A high precision programmable AC source is a specialized instrument designed to generate clean, stable, and adjustable AC power signals. It is widely used in research, manufacturing, and quality assurance to simulate real-world power conditions for testing electrical equipment. These devices are essential for industries requiring precise control over voltage, frequency, and waveform characteristics. They help ensure compliance with international standards and improve product reliability.

Structure and Working Principle

The device consists of a digital signal processor (DSP), power amplifier, and output transformer, enabling precise waveform generation. The DSP controls the output parameters, while the amplifier ensures signal stability. Feedback mechanisms maintain accuracy by continuously monitoring and adjusting the output. This closed-loop design minimizes distortion and provides consistent performance under varying load conditions.

Key Features

High precision programmable AC sources offer adjustable voltage (typically 0–300V) and frequency (45Hz–1kHz or higher), with low harmonic distortion (<0.5%). They support remote operation via interfaces like GPIB, USB, or Ethernet. Advanced models include features such as arbitrary waveform generation, phase shifting, and synchronized multi-channel outputs, making them versatile for complex testing scenarios.

Application Areas

These devices are critical in power electronics testing, including inverters, transformers, and uninterruptible power supplies (UPS). They are also used in automotive and aerospace industries for validating onboard electrical systems. Laboratories and certification bodies rely on them for compliance testing with IEC, IEEE, and other regulatory standards.

Maintenance and Precautions

Regular calibration is necessary to maintain accuracy. Avoid exposing the device to extreme temperatures or humidity, and ensure proper ventilation during operation. Always verify load compatibility before testing to prevent damage. Follow the manufacturer’s guidelines for firmware updates and preventive maintenance.

B2B Procurement Guide

When purchasing a high precision programmable AC source, evaluate the required voltage/frequency range, accuracy, and additional features like harmonic injection or transient simulation. Reputable suppliers often provide customization options and post-sale support, including calibration services. Compare lead times and warranty terms before finalizing a purchase.
